Output ebf03b74557c369099de7fe421e8501cc03b66ff31df0dbfd70ce93e045061f2:2

value
75513914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a06116cadfbe29ab4f1dea67958764e53aaf94d OP_EQUAL
address
MDBxhAyngaV48U6xqfGNKiApLhN9mkDf8i
transaction
ebf03b74557c369099de7fe421e8501cc03b66ff31df0dbfd70ce93e045061f2
spent
true